Chesterfield has an appealing food and drink scene, with established pubs alongside more contemporary eateries. The town’s culinary character is shaped by its Derbyshire location, with locally sourced ingredients becoming increasingly prominent. Look for menus featuring Derbyshire cheeses like Stilton or Long Clawson Dale, and locally brewed ales from Peak Ales. This is a starting point for discovering places to eat and drink in Chesterfield.
For a relaxed pace, you can find traditional pub lunches and cosy tearooms. These places provide a chance to sample regional specialities, such as Bakewell Pudding or Derbyshire oatcakes, and often feature seasonal offerings. The town’s market is a good place to find local produce and artisan breads when open. Expect well-prepared classics and comfortable surroundings, a place to enjoy a meal and conversation. Consider exploring the options around the Old Town, where several independent establishments offer this experience.
